Bruce,

So use the work-around I described earlier. The program's default destination is My Documents\My Music (at least, that's where I eventually found the first tracks I ripped with version 12.). So let the program rip your tracks to there, then cut and paste them where you really want them.

> Bruce,
>
> Off to the right of the combo box that lets you choose a drive letter > for
> the destination of your ripped files, there is a graphical icon of a
> folder.
> I just got some sighted assistance to help me place the mouse pointer on
> that icon, and label it, with the graphics labeler. Now, when I switch > to
> the JAWS cursor and click on that icon, a dialogue opens that lets me
> choose
> a subfolder of the drive, as the destination folder.
>
> Of course, once you've selected the destination you wish, it remains
> selected as the new default destination, until you change it; so you'll
> never need to play with that icon again, unless you want to change the
> destination, for some reason.

> >I have a bunch of completely legal CD's that I want to conver to
> > completely legal MP3's. Each disk is one track, so I don't have to > > worry > > about choosing tracks or anything like that. Has anyone at least > > gotten,
> > in Easy CD-DA Extractor 12, the "choose a location" feature to work
> > correctly? I don't have the fabled version 9, and besides, I want to > > use
> > the new extraction engine in 12 to do this. I would use Exact Audio
> > Copy, but EAC does not like these disks. Anyone have any thoughts?
